| Furniture production consists of a very important part of our country’s industrial production. With the improvement of material culture and living standards, the demand for environment-friendly furniture which is not only beautifully designed but also can satisfy the needs of life and work is increasing, which requires the furniture to be embellished and spray-painted. The painting process will produce a certain amount of waste water which contains a lot of pollutants including various kinds of organic solvents and nondegradable organic dyes. The existing municipal wastewater treatment plants cannot effectively deal with this wastewater. What’s more, the quantity of wastewater produced by each painting factory is relatively less, which makes it difficult for the wastewater treatment equipment to work effectively all the time, so with its poor treatment effect, a special wastewater treatment equipment is almost impossible to meet the related emission standards of environmental protection and the requirement of total amount control, especially in towns like Longjiang Town where the furniture production enterprises are mainly in small and medium size. Because of the difficulty to establish an effective wastewater pipe network, the problem of pollution is becoming more and more severe in such places.On the basis of understanding Longjiang River’s pollution status, this study carries out a special investigation to the problem of serious furniture spraying-paint wastewater pollution in Longjiang Town. First, by means of conducting a field research on the source of the furniture spraying-paint wastewater pollution, the study tends to understand the number and distribution of the furniture manufacturing enterprises and find out the existing production of spraying-paint wastewater, the variety and nature of the pollutants and the sewage collection and discharge situation in Longjiang Town, then analyze the rate that the furniture spraying-paint wastewater pollution takes on the river pollution. Second, by looking in details at the spraying-paint wastewater’s quantity, quality and their problems, the study conducts a deep research and investigation into the characteristics of the wastewater. At last, according to the wastewater’s quality, quantity and its collection and discharge characteristics, the study puts forward a combined process:hydrolytic acidification+aerobic biological contact oxidation, which is suitable to spraying-painting wastewater treatment and has been successfully applied in practical use.On this basis, this study analyzes the causes of the furniture spraying-paint wastewater pollution and put forwards corresponding measures to control the pollution:1. The furniture manufacturing enterprises in Longjiang Town are large in quantity, small in size and wide and scattered in distribution.2. The river going through Longjiang Town is severely polluted. The pollution comes mainly from the rural domestic sewage and industrial wastewater. And the industrial wastewater comes mainly from furniture spraying-painting wastewater. The quantity of the rural domestic sewage COD into the river for each day accounts to2800.3tons. The quantity of the furniture spraying-paint wastewater into the river reaches947.8tons every day, taking almost25%of the total pollution.3. The total quantity of the spraying-paint wastewater is large but the unit amount is small and the fluctuation is great. The average value of wastewater for every furniture enterprise is1.12tons every day. The total amount of wastewater for all furniture enterprises reaches up to1200tons every day.4. The wastewater remains no collection, no treatment and is discharged at will. Most of the enterprises pour their wastewater into the river, and only little of the wastewater is centralized processed by the environmental protection company after door-to door recovery.5. The BODs/CODcr value of the spraying-paint wastewater is smaller than0.3, which makes it difficult to biodegrade. The range of the quality fluctuation is great. The fluctuation range of COD is between6.9to8731mg/L, the fluctuation range of suspended solids is between1to8482mg/L and the range of PH is between5to7. The wastewater’s value of COD and suspended solids for primer spray is higher than for top-coating. The number of days for the circulating water in the water curtain machine to reach saturation state is between10to15days, so the replacement frequency for the circulating water is2to3times a month.6. On the basis of theoretically analyzing the feasibility of the combined process:hydrolytic acidification+aerobic biological contact oxidation, the process is also verified by engineering examples:we take PAM and PFS coagulation and sedimentation combined process to pre-process the furniture spraying-painting wastewater. By this way, the removal rate of COD can get as high as45.1%.If applying the combined process " hydrolytic acidification+aerobic biological contact oxidation" to deal with the spraying-paint wastewater, the removal rate of COD and suspended solids reaches96.3%and82.3%respectively. Effluent COD and SS keep steady at under90mg/L and55mg/L, meeting the Grade One wastewater emission standard in Guangdong Province. |
